Aaand it works on Linux - shepherd messages show up on the console and 
eventually
end up in syslog (I checked).  Integration is surprisingly easy and safe 
(shepherd
already does line buffering manually):

diff --git a/gnu/packages/admin.scm b/gnu/packages/admin.scm
index ccf62a6e2..168495c14 100644
--- a/gnu/packages/admin.scm
+++ b/gnu/packages/admin.scm
@@ -169,7 +169,15 @@ and provides a \"top-like\" mode (monitoring).")
               (patches (search-patches "shepherd-close-fds.patch"))))
     (build-system gnu-build-system)
     (arguments
-     '(#:configure-flags '("--localstatedir=/var")))
+     '(#:configure-flags '("--localstatedir=/var")
+       #:tests? #f ; I broke them, sorry
+       #:phases
+       (modify-phases %standard-phases
+        (add-after 'unpack 'patch-kmsg
+          (lambda _
+            (substitute* "modules/shepherd/support.scm"
+             (("%localstatedir \"/log/shepherd.log\"") "\"/dev/kmsg\""))
+            #t)))))
     (native-inputs
      `(("pkg-config" ,pkg-config)

Timestamp is printed twice, though (shepherd prints one, too).

$ cat /var/log/messages
[...]
Feb 16 23:01:58 localhost vmunix: [    9.178841] Console: switching to colour 
frame buffer device 160x50
Feb 16 23:01:58 localhost vmunix: [    9.198267] i915 0000:00:02.0: fb0: 
inteldrmfb frame buffer device
Feb 16 23:01:58 localhost vmunix: [    9.229274] 2018-02-16 23:01:32 Service 
udev has been started. <----- hellooooo
Feb 16 23:01:58 localhost vmunix: [   25.232541] NET: Registered protocol 
family 38

Note: 9.229274 is [Fr Feb 16 23:01:32 2018] (as checked by "dmesg -T"),
so syslogd is kinda off here.  Maybe they print the time of their /dev/kmsg
readout action... that would be weird.

Maybe this would remove the duplicate timestamp:
